377-104A JGA Bogie Hopper with Hopper Cover 'Tilcon' Grey No.NACO19175 Brand_Marklin and bogiesThe JGA Bogie Hoppers were built in Slovakia in the mid 1990s for Buxton Lime Industries and Tilcon, primarily working from Tunstead Quarry, operated by Buxton Lime Industries, near Buxton on the edge of the Peak District. Consisting of a large hopper with three pairs of bottom discharge doors, the wagons were used to transport lime products from the quarry for distribution around the UK.
